How Florida Was Ordered To Play Florida State
quote:

Governor LeRoy Collins entered the fray.

Governor Collins had been outraged that a bill had even been placed on the floor of the Senate. He believed that the State Legislature had more important things to do than schedule football games.

His outrage intensified to extreme anger, when he learned that as many as three other bills were in the process of being written.

He decided to act.

He summoned both Presidents to the Governor's Mansion for a meeting.

There are no official documents of what was said in that meeting, but whatever was said worked. Within a matter of a few weeks the Presidents of both Florida State and Florida appeared before the Board of Control and asked that the Board initiate action that would result in the two schools competing against each other in all sports.

A game was close, but still not official.

The Board turned the situation over to the athletic departments of both schools to finalize everything. Despite numerous meetings, nothing could be concluded and negotiations dragged on for another 6 months.

Finally, a still angry and now agitated Governor Collins ordered both President Campbell of Florida State and President Reitz of Florida to return to Tallahassee to meet with him and the Board of Control.

Collins would later be quoted..."there are some things that are better off not being mentioned in the sunshine," when he was asked why the meeting was behind locked doors.

The only thing known for certain is that when the meeting ended the Board of Control announced that Florida will play Florida State in football next year.

The headlines of the Tallahassee Democrat stated..."UF-FSU FOOTBALL ORDERED".

It would later be determined that the University of Florida did indeed have some contractual issues and they were granted a grace period from the Board of Control, and were ordered to play Florida State in 1958.

Fiction: There was never a law enacted that ordered Florida to play Florida State in Football.

Fact: The State Board of Control Ordered Florida to play Florida State in Football.
